Encino, Calif.-based NAS Insurance Services has a new network security insurance called NetGuard, which covers allegations against an insured such as breach of privacy, identity theft, etc.
NetGuard includes gvernment investigations defense cost insurance such as government investigations into HIPAA and other federal or state violations. The program also provides data recovery costs insurance, covering recovery of electronic data lost by hacking, computer virus attack and other systems invasions.
NetGuard is available to specialty carriers to provide their insureds with ancillary insurance protection. Various structures and limits are available. NAS works with reinsurance intermediaries to structure program for their clients.
